Mt. Gilead lost against Centerburg back in January and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Thursday. The contest between the Mt. Gilead Indians and the Centerburg Trojans didn't end well, with the Mt. Gilead Indians falling 42-27. While losing is never fun, the Indians can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Ohio basketball rankings (they are ranked 483rd, while the Trojans are ranked 133rd).
Mt. Gilead's loss dropped their record down to 10-13. As for Centerburg, the win (which was their fourth in a row) raised their record to 20-3.
Mt. Gilead does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Centerburg, they will take on East Knox in a tournament on Tuesday. Centerburg's defense has only allowed 28.3 points per game this season, so East Knox's offense will have their work cut out for them.
